Are you ready to make an impact on talent acquisition across some of the most exciting and diverse regions of Europe? Based out of our stunning Newcastle office we're looking for a passionate and skilled
Talent Acquisition Specialist
to support recruitment efforts across Denmark, Finland, Norway, and Sweden. This is your chance to shape the future of recruitment in a fast-paced, international environment, while building connections across cultures and borders.
What You'll Do:
- Source Top Talent:
Use your creative and tech-savvy approach to source the best candidates across multiple countries. Whether it's through local job boards, social media, or recruitment platforms, you'll be the key to connecting with exceptional professionals. - Navigate Local Markets:
From the bustling tech scene in Poland to the forward-thinking workplaces in Sweden and Denmark, you'll tap into diverse talent pools and adapt recruitment strategies to fit the unique needs of each country. - Build Relationships:
Develop strong networks with universities, local agencies, and industry leaders. Be the face of our company in each country, fostering relationships and promoting our employer brand. - Compliance & Market Insights:
Ensure all recruitment efforts comply with local laws, while staying on top of trends in each region's job market. You'll be the expert in labour laws, salary expectations, and talent trends in every country you recruit for. - Stakeholder Collaboration:
Work closely with hiring managers across borders to understand their unique needs and deliver customised recruitment solutions. - Offer Negotiation & Brand Building:
Create enticing offers for candidates while strengthening our employer brand. Your negotiation skills will ensure we attract the best talent, while maintaining a competitive edge in each region.
What We're Looking For:
- Cultural Curiosity:
You thrive on understanding cultural differences and adapt your approach to connect with talent from a variety of backgrounds. You know how to navigate different communication styles and work ethics to build trust and rapport. - Multilingual Ability:
Fluency in English is essential, but additional language skills (Danish, Finnish, Swedish, or Norwegian) will set you apart and help you build deeper connections in the local markets. - Expert Knowledge of Local Labor Laws:
You're up-to-date with employment laws and regulations in each country, ensuring we're always compliant and strategic in our recruitment efforts. - Networking Pro:
You know how to connect with candidates, universities, agencies, and industry professionals. Your network is your superpower. - Tech-Savvy & Data-Driven:
You know how to leverage recruitment tools, ATS systems, and analytics to optimize your process and results. - Adaptable & Flexible:
Every country and every talent pool is different—and you're ready to pivot when needed, navigating the complexities of multiple time zones, hiring trends, and evolving business needs. - Passionate About People:
You understand that recruitment isn't just about filling positions; it's about making meaningful connections and creating opportunities for growth and success.
